Everything you need to know about Llangadog Station

Exploring Llangadog Station

If you find yourself nestled in the central landscapes of Wales, Llangadog train station offers an idyllic, albeit simple, gateway for your travels. This station is a part of the Heart of Wales Line and serves the quaint village of Llangadog in Carmarthenshire. It's perfect for those seeking a peaceful start to their journeys, away from the bustling crowds of larger stations.

Facilities at Llangadog Station

Llangadog station embodies simplicity. While it lacks many of the amenities you might expect elsewhere—it doesn't have a ticket office, ticket machines, or even a waiting room—it’s perfectly equipped for those who value ease and accessibility. There's step-free access throughout the entire station, making it convenient for all travelers. And if you're planning to purchase your ticket, it's best to do so online beforehand, as there's no facility for ticket collection onsite.

Customer support at the station is limited but available through a dedicated helpline. Screens that display departure and arrival information help keep passengers informed. Moreover, the installation of an induction loop ensures those with hearing impairments are supported. However, for any specific accessibility concerns or to request travel assistance, travelers are encouraged to book through Passenger Assist.

Connectivity and Accessibility

Transport connections from Llangadog are modest yet sufficient. For overland travel, a rail replacement bus service stops right at the station entrance. This makes it a viable option for journeys that require a little flexibility, especially concerning travel disruptions. As for cycling enthusiasts, there aren’t any storage facilities available which makes it essential to consider alternate arrangements if you're bringing a bike.

Everything you need to know about Sankey for Penketh Station

Welcome to Sankey for Penketh Station

Nestled in the historic borough of Warrington lies Sankey for Penketh, a rail station brimming with potential adventure. Whether you're a local commuter or a visitor eager to explore nearby attractions, you'll find Sankey for Penketh Station to be a convenient gateway to several destinations. While its facilities may be modest, the station’s charm resides in its accessibility to key towns and the surrounding scenic beauty.

Facilities and Amenities

Sankey for Penketh Station is streamlined for ease and efficiency. Despite the absence of a traditional ticket office, automated ticket machines are available for those who need to collect pre-purchased tickets. Unfortunately, these machines are not accessible for wheelchair users. The station’s amenities include essential passenger information like departure screens and announcements to keep travelers informed.

The station is categorized under accessibility as a Category B, offering partial step-free access, and passengers requiring step-free passage can contact the Travel Assistance Helpline. While facilities like toilets, waiting rooms, or shops are missing, travelers can enjoy free car parking, though spaces are limited to ten. Bicycle storage is not available; however, nearby cycle routes in the picturesque Cheshire plains might entice cycling enthusiasts.

Onward Transportation Connections

Connectivity is where Sankey for Penketh excels. The station is well-linked with the rest of the North West through reliable train services. If you're headed to prominent cities like Liverpool or Manchester, you can easily catch a bus or a taxi from the station’s vicinity. For those heading to Liverpool, the bus stop is conveniently located on Station Road. Rail replacement services also use this stop; the side closest to the station caters to Liverpool-bound trains, while the opposite side is for those bound towards Manchester.

For taxi services, arrangements can be made via Northern Railway’s Cab4you service, ensuring easy transit to your final destination. Unfortunately, while the potential for cycle hire is noted, it remains unavailable at the station.
